| Contents | Notions of women in Hispanic didactic literature -- Unstable sex, unstable voices : Alfonso Martínez de Toledo's Arcipreste de Talavera -- Present laughter : Bernat Metge's Lo somni and Jaume Roig's Spill -- The Defences -- Torroella's Maldezir de mugeres and its Legacy. |
| Abstract | "This books argues that the problem of gender identity is vital to the large corpus of medieval Hispanic texts that discuss the nature of women"--Provided by publisher. |
